.DISCUSSION... Issued at 1254 AM EDT Tue Sep 30 2025
The pattern consists of pinched ridging aloft over the Mississippi Valley with associated strong surface high pressure over Ontario, and an eventual eastern shift to Quebec. Tropical Storm Imelda and Hurricane Humberto almost spin in unison within troughing to our east. The only impacts we can expect from them, will be increased moisture and instability later today to support showers and thunderstorms. Best chances (40-50%) will be along the Appalachians extending from southwest VA south to southwest NC. Parts of the valley may experience anywhere from a 20-35% chance of precipitation. The most recent SPC Outlook for today circles most of our forecast area only for general thunderstorms. Persistent cloud cover today will notably keep temperatures cooler across our most eastern locations.
After a couple of warmer than normal days, a dry pattern will be underway Wednesday, persisting until around the middle of the weekend. Temperatures will be a couple of degrees cooler. Drier air will also follow suit. The next chance for precipitation may not be until towards the end of the forecast period when moisture is advected north from a Gulf Coast frontal boundary.

.AVIATION... (12Z TAFS) Issued at 700 AM EDT Tue Sep 30 2025
ISOLD to SCT SHRA and perhaps a few embedded TSRA are expected across east TN this afternoon. Confidence is pretty low, but the best signals in guidance favor KTRI and KCHA seeing some. Otherwise the only concern in the 12z TAF period will be whether fog development occurs tonight. Calm winds and thinning high clouds would seem to favor it. Added in some MVFR VSBY at KTRI late tonight to account for this.
